This process is beneficial for all people, religious and secular, people living an ordinary life, and achievers in all areas of life. In fact, the more free your mind is from any concepts, the easier it is to make progress. You don’t need to belong to any religion to engage in the process of spiritual growth. Though all religions speak about spirituality, this concept does not belong exclusively to any religion or tradition. It is not so much a process of growth, as a process of widening your awareness, opening your mind, and seeing life from a wider perspective. It is a process of widening the horizons of your consciousness, and understanding some inner truths. Spiritual growth is an inner process of removing obsolete ideas and habits, wrong concepts, and erroneous beliefs and ideas about life.
